You can exercise with a bulging disc as long as the activities are gentle and performed in slow, ... christmas trees with built in led lightsWebThe main difference between herniated discs and bulging discs is that herniated discs involve the nucleus leaking out of the annulus. With a bulging disc, the walls of the annulus are not ruptured, just weakened.
